Our hosts the Maharshi Bhardwaja Society arranged our 25 hr train trip from Dehli to Hyderabad. We traveled with Steven Knapp, Vrin Parker. S.D. Youngwolf and Manish Matel (our gracious guide). We spoke at the "Global Hinduism in the New Millennium Conference" where the key note was delivered by David Frawley. This conference was co- sponsored by the VFA Vedic Friends Association International and lasted for 2 days. during one of the sessions we were whisked from the conference in a government car to speak to about 300 graduate students at a local business college. They were so eager and attentive to both Jeffrey's talk and Vrin Parkers. One young lady sketched a beautiful baby Krishna during the talk and presented it to us after the talk. What has amazed me about India so far is the rapidity at which the can rally a large group of people. They say no problem and so far they really mean it! Last night we had our final dinner together as a group and we were hosted by M.G. Sharyam and his most gracious family. The S. Indian food was incredible. We were only sorry we were whisked away so early! David Frawley leaves for America, Vrin, Stephen and Youngwolf leave for Nagaland and we will stay 3 days more before we leave for Bangalore. Our current host is a young entrepeneur who has just started a TV station called Parampara. In the space of 24 hrs he has arranged to publish a book with us, create a future speaking tour in India, a seminar 2 days from now co-sponsored by the Taj Krishna Hotel (one of the most prestigious hotels in Hyderabad). They will invite about 200 of their elite club members and the TV station will also invite their VIP lists. Title of the talk is Traditional at Heart – Modern in Outlook. Jeffrey will also speak at the closing ceremonies of a scholastic event held for 3,000 young ladies tomorrow during the day. At this moment all we can say is that were have been incredibly blessed with our reception in India and ever grateful to be able to serve in this way.
